    Cold radiators

    My upstairs rads were cold and bleeding them did no good. Denmark came out and immediately determined that my water pressure was low. They made an adjustment or two and after I bled the rads (while they were checking out the water pump) the rads warmed up. They found a minor leak in the water pump but suggested it could wait. They also found a possible problem with a galvanized elbow but again suggested waiting till after the heating system. They were finished in half an hour. I was thoroughly impressed with their work and strongly recommend them.
